USCCA Conceal Carry Fundamentals 8-Hour Initial Course: This course is taught by verified instructors and meets the new state requirements under the law C.R.S. 18-12-202.5. It qualifies you to apply for your Colorado Concealed Handgun Permit in your county of residence. It includes a certificate of completion for inclusion in your application packet. The class includes instruction on safe handling of firearms and ammunition, safe storage of firearms and child safety, and shooting fundamentals. This course discusses developing a personal and home protection plan, self-defense firearm basics, defensive shooting fundamentals, the legal use of force, violent encounters and their aftermath, gears and gadgets and basic to advanced skills. Live range shooting is part of the course and can be scheduled on an individual basis. Have a group interested? Special, private class times can be arranged.

USCCA CCW Refresher Course: This course is taught by Verified Instructors and meets the new state requirements under the law C.R.S. 18-12-202.5. It qualifies you to renew your Colorado Concealed Handgun Permit in your county of residence. It includes a certificate of completion. Live range shooting is included and required to complete this course. The live fire course is designed for shooters of all experience levels – from novice to advanced shooters. The class requires students to demonstrate safety and competence with a handgun. It includes instruction on changes to federal and state laws pertaining to the lawful purchase, ownership, transportation, use, and possession of firearms, including instruction on extreme risk protection orders. It will educate you on state law pertaining to the use of deadly force for self-defense. Have a group interested? Special, private class times can be arranged.

2026 Spring & Summer Sporting Clay League Information
Both the Spring & Summer leagues will be a competitive “for fun” league with prize money paid to the top 25% of teams along with a
weekly Lewis class payout. Each league will run for 10 shoot weeks. Please read below for League details, if you have any additional
questions please email SportingClaysLeague@gmail.com or check out www.sportingclayleague.com
League Details:
$500 entry fee for the 10 week league. Prize money will be paying out to a weekly High Overall (HOA) and Lewis class of 3 random
paying $50 to each placing. No split money, ties will be broken by rolling dice for the tie breaker station on your scorecard. Team
payout will be to the top 25% of teams.
If there are weather cancellations, the league will be extended additional weeks for a total of 10 complete shoot weeks. Any weather
cancellations will be made via email, however we shoot rain or shine and will only postpone due to safety or extreme weather
conditions.
100 Targets per week that must be shot between 2:30PM and completed by 7:00PM or Sunset (whichever is earlier) on Wednesday
nights. You must provide your own ammunition. Firearms are available for rent and ammo is available to be purchased at Colorado
Clays. NSCA Scoring rules will be in place (although again, non-registered league). All Colorado Clays safety rules must be followed at
all times. Safety is always #1 and all shooters should police each other for safety.
No individual shooter rain checks or makeup dates allowed. If you miss a scheduled week or you are unable to shoot that night, you
get a “dog score” which will be 5 targets below what your current average score is. There are NO refunds for missed weeks and you
cannot have someone shoot in your place.
How teams work – Teams of 5 shooters will be setup via a draft style selection the week before league begins. This allows a fair
opportunity for all teams to have the chance to win, there will be no “ringer” teams. This also eliminates the need for shooters to build a
full team to enter the league. How the draft works is that team captains will be selected at random and the captains will complete a
‘draft’ of who is on each team (think NFL/NBA style draft). If there are uneven number of people to complete teams, a captain will be
able to draft a ‘dog score’ for the final position which will be the average of shooters taken in that round.
You do not need to shoot with your drafted team, and you do not need to do anything to be part of the draft, all you do is sign up for the
league! We will announce the teams before league begins via email.
This will be euro rotation squads which means you can shoot with anyone you want at any time on league day. If you want to meet
new people, shoot with a new group! Historically many shooters start shooting between 3:30-4:30. Please try to have 3+ shooters per
squad when shooting. If you need another shooter on your squad, just wait at the picnic tables for someone to show up.
Weekly scores are available on www.sportingclayleague.com with the winners of the Lewis class prizes. The following week an
envelope will be available at the Colorado Clays front desk with your prize money in it.
